| 351 | _aArranged in 3 series. Series 1: Diaries and Notebooks, 1862-1867; Series 2: General Correspondence and Related Material, 1855-1908; and Series 3: Miscellany, 1847-1862. | ||
| 506 | 0 | _aOpen to research. | |
| 520 | 8 | _aCorrespondence, memoranda, diaries, memoirs, reports, notebooks, orders, memoirs, sketches, and other papers primarily concerning Comstock's Civil War service as chief engineer of the Army of the Potomac. | |
| 520 | 8 | _aTopics include the siege of Vicksburg, Miss.; the capture of Fort Fisher, N.C.; the fords on the Rapidan and Rappahannock rivers, Va.; the defenses at Aquia Creek, Va. and Harpers Ferry, W. Va.; Ulysses S. Grant's resignation as U.S. secretary of war under Andrew Johnson; James K. Polk's 1847 annual message to Congress concerning the Mexican War; Comstock's service as president of the U.S. Mississippi River Commission (1884) including improvement of the Mississippi River; the ancestry of Jesse Root Grant; and William Petit Trowbridge. | |
| 520 | 8 | _aCorrespondents include Henry Martyn Adams, B.S. Alexander, Daniel Butterfield, James Buchanan Eads, Ulysses S. Grant, H.W. Halleck, A.A. Humphreys, George Gordon Meade, David D. Porter, John McAllister Schofield, Philip Henry Sheridan, William T. Sherman, Daniel Edgar Sickles, E.D. Townsend, Seth Williams, and Horatio Gouverneur Wright. | |
